Understanding Battery Capacity and Cycle Life

When reading a best rechargeable batteries review, the two most important metrics you will encounter are milliampere-hours (mAh) and cycle life. Capacity, measured in mAh, tells you how much energy the battery can hold, which directly translates to how long your device will run on a single charge. High-capacity batteries are generally preferred for high-drain devices like digital cameras and motorized toys.

Cycle life refers to the number of times a battery can be recharged and discharged before its capacity begins to significantly degrade. While some batteries boast high mAh ratings, they may have a lower cycle life. Balancing these two factors is key to finding a product that provides value over several years of use.

Low Self-Discharge Technology

One of the most significant advancements in the industry is Low Self-Discharge (LSD) technology. In the past, rechargeable batteries would lose their charge while sitting in a drawer, often becoming flat within weeks. Modern LSD batteries can retain up to 70-85% of their charge even after a year of non-use, making them ideal for emergency flashlights and remote controls.

The Importance of a Quality Battery Charger

A best rechargeable batteries review would be incomplete without mentioning the importance of the charging unit itself. Using a cheap, “dumb” charger that works on a simple timer can lead to overcharging, which generates heat and permanently damages the internal chemistry of your batteries. This significantly shortens their lifespan and reduces their ability to hold a charge.

Investing in a “smart” charger is highly recommended. These devices monitor the voltage of each individual cell and stop charging as soon as the battery is full. Some advanced chargers even offer a “refresh” mode, which can help recover older batteries that have developed a memory effect or have been sitting idle for too long.

Lithium-ion vs. NiMH Rechargeables

While NiMH is the standard for AA and AAA sizes, Lithium-ion (Li-ion) rechargeable batteries are becoming more common. Li-ion batteries provide a constant 1.5V output until they are depleted, whereas NiMH voltage drops gradually as the battery drains. This makes Li-ion excellent for devices that require a steady voltage to function correctly, though they often require specialized charging cables or ports.

Maximizing Your Battery Investment

To get the most out of your purchase, it is important to follow a few best practices. Avoid exposing your batteries to extreme temperatures, as both high heat and freezing cold can damage the chemical structure. If you are storing batteries for a long period, it is best to keep them in a cool, dry place with about a 40-50% charge rather than fully depleted.

Labeling your batteries in sets can also be helpful. Using batteries of the same age and capacity together ensures that one cell doesn’t drain faster than the others, which can lead to cell reversal and permanent damage. Keeping “married” sets for specific devices is a common strategy among power users to ensure peak performance.
